serein

IPA: /səˈreɪn/

KK: /səˈrɛn/

noun

Definition: A light rain that falls from a clear sky, usually occurring after sunset.

Example: The serene evening was marked by a gentle serein that refreshed the garden.

sericeous

IPA: /səˈrɪʃəs/

KK: /səˈrɪʃəs/

adjective

Definition: Describing a surface that is covered with soft, silky hairs, often giving it a smooth or fine texture.

Example: The leaves of the plant were sericeous, making them feel soft to the touch.

sericulture

IPA: /ˈsɛrɪˌkʌltʃər/

KK: /sɛrɪˌkʌltʃər/

noun

Definition: The practice of raising silkworms to produce silk.

Example: In China, sericulture has been an important industry for thousands of years.

seringa

IPA: /səˈrɪŋə/

KK: /səˈrɪŋə/

noun

Definition: A type of tree found in Brazil that produces rubber.

Example: The seringa tree is important for rubber production in Brazil.

serotinal

IPA: //ˈsɛrəˌtɪnəl//

KK: /sɛˈrɑːtɪnəl/

adjective

Definition: Relating to the later part of summer, often characterized by drier conditions.

Example: The serotinal season brought warm days and cool nights, perfect for outdoor activities.

serotine

IPA: //ˈsɛrəˌtiːn//

KK: /sɛrətin/

noun

Definition: A type of medium-sized bat that is commonly found in Europe, Asia, and Africa, known for its insect-eating habits.

Example: The serotine bat is often seen flying at dusk in search of insects.

serotinous

IPA: /səˈrɒtɪnəs/

KK: /səˈrɒtɪnəs/

adjective

Definition: Referring to plants that develop or bloom late, or that remain closed while gradually releasing seeds.

Example: The serotinous cones of the pine tree only open after a fire, allowing seeds to disperse in a nutrient-rich environment.

serpent

IPA: /ˈsɜːrənt/

KK: /ˈsɜːrpənt/

noun

Definition: A long, legless reptile that is often found in various environments and is known for its ability to slither and sometimes for its venomous bite.

Example: The serpent slithered silently through the grass, searching for its next meal.

serpentine

IPA: /ˈsɜːrpəntaɪn/

KK: /ˈsɜr.pən.tin/

adjective

Definition: Having a shape or movement like a snake; winding and curvy.

Example: The road ahead was serpentine, twisting through the hills.

noun

Definition: A type of mineral that is usually greenish or brownish and is often used in architecture and as a source of magnesium and asbestos.

Example: The sculptor chose serpentine for its unique color and texture in his latest work.

serpentinely

IPA: /ˈsɜː.pəntɪnli/

KK: /ˈsɜr.pən.tin.li/

adverb

Definition: In a way that is winding or twisting, similar to the movement of a snake.

Example: The road serpentinely wound through the mountains, offering stunning views at every turn.
